Quicken Deluxe 2017 Software No Subscription Install ❲AUTHENTIC - OVERVIEW❳

Quicken Deluxe 2017: How to Install and Use Without a Subscription

Quicken Deluxe 2017 was the final major "standalone" release before the software transitioned to a mandatory subscription model. While Quicken Inc. has officially discontinued support for this version as of April 30, 2020, many users still prefer its perpetual license.

However, installing it today on a new computer or Windows 11 system can be tricky due to modern registration requirements and security updates. 1. The Challenges of a "No Subscription" Install

Installing Quicken Deluxe 2017 without a current subscription presents several hurdles:

Mandatory Registration: Even though it's a "perpetual" version, the installer often requires a Quicken ID login to verify the license.

Server Incompatibility: Modern Quicken servers use updated security protocols that the 2017 version does not recognize, which can lead to blank login boxes or errors.

No Official Downloads: Quicken Inc. no longer provides official replacement downloads for discontinued versions like 2017. You must have your original installation CD or a saved installer file. 2. Step-by-Step Installation Process quicken deluxe 2017 software no subscription install

If you have your original installer, follow these steps to set it up manually:

Run the Installer: Launch your Quicken 2017 .exe or insert the CD. Follow the on-screen prompts to unpack files and accept the license agreement.

Choose Installation Path: You can use the default directory or select a custom location.

Handle the Login Screen: After installation, the software will ask you to sign in. If the box is blank or returns an error, it is likely because the internal browser in the 2017 version cannot connect to modern Quicken servers.

Apply Final Patches: Before launching, ensure you have the latest "Mondo" patch for 2017 (typically R20.6 or similar). Without these patches, the software may be unstable on Windows 10 or 11. 3. The "Quicken.ini" Workaround

For users moving Quicken 2017 to a new computer, the most successful community-tested method involves bypassing the registration screen by copying a specific configuration file from an old installation. Quicken Deluxe 2017: How to Install and Use

Locate the File: On your old computer, find Quicken.ini located in C:\Users\[Username]\AppData\Roaming\Quicken\config.

Transfer to New PC: Install Quicken 2017 on the new computer, then copy your old Quicken.ini file into the same folder on the new machine, overwriting the new file.

Why it works: This file contains "registration flags" that tell the software it has already been activated, often bypassing the need to connect to Quicken’s servers. 4. How to Use Quicken 2017 in "Manual Mode"

Once installed, Quicken Deluxe 2017 will no longer support online banking, automatic transaction downloads, or bill pay services. You can still use it effectively by: Quicken 2017 Data Import: Best Version for Windows 11 Q&A

2. Pre-installation checklist


Part 1: The Legacy – Why Quicken 2017 is Still Relevant

Quicken Inc. (now owned by H.I.G. Capital, formerly part of Intuit) changed its business model significantly after the 2017 version. Prior to 2018, Quicken operated on a "perpetual license" model. You paid for the software once, installed it via CD-ROM or digital download, and used it for as long as your operating system supported it.

Quicken Deluxe 2017 represents the end of an era. Here is why this specific version commands a cult following: Valid product key for Quicken Deluxe 2017

The "Perpetual License" Advantage

When you purchase Quicken Deluxe 2017, you are buying a product, not a service. There is no mandatory login every 30 days to verify a subscription. There is no credit card on file. Once the product key is activated, the software is yours indefinitely.

Step 3 – Activation (The Problem Area)

When you first launch Quicken 2017:

  1. Enter your license key.
  2. It will try to connect to Quicken’s activation server → This will likely fail.
  3. Options if it fails:
    • Phone activation – Look for a toll‑free number in the error dialog. Call and enter the provided code. (May no longer work.)
    • Offline activation – Not available for 2017.
    • Workaround – Set system date to late 2016 / early 2017, disable internet, install. This can bypass server checks but is not guaranteed.

⚠️ Without successful activation, Quicken will run in 30‑day trial mode then lock.


Step 1: Source the Installer

You need the original installer. This is the hardest part. You cannot download it from Quicken’s official website anymore (they redirect to the 2024 subscription version). You can find the installer on:

The Critical Reality Check: Downloading vs. Bank Connectivity

Before you install, you must understand the one major caveat. When searching for Quicken Deluxe 2017 software no subscription install, most users assume it will work exactly like it did in 2017. It will not.

5. Compatibility and functionality considerations


Installing on Windows 11

Quicken 2017 is 32-bit software. Windows 11 runs it surprisingly well via compatibility mode.

  1. Right-click the installer > Properties > Compatibility tab.
  2. Check "Run this program in compatibility mode for:" and select Windows 8 or Windows 7.
  3. Check "Run as Administrator."
  4. Apply and run.